I know that some people put in a whole GTR rear cradle that has all the diff, shafts etc already there, Abo Bob is one member that has done the GTR upgrade, so he would be more helpfull with the details.

The 25 box is basically the same as a late R33GTR gear box so they are pretty strong, especially for RWD. Only weaknesses are third gear and synchros at high rev fast shifts.

Os giken and Par etc are a couple of gearset upgrades available.

Buy complete r32/33 GTR rear cradle.

Use the axles, hubs and diff out of it .

Throw the rest in the bin.

If you want a 1.5 way you will have to get that done at same time.

Fairly easy exercise. Wont need to worrie about breaking axles again.

I have just done the conversion into my R34 GTT

I paid $700 from a mate for the the lot from an R32 GTR. My traction control stopped working, and presumably the ABS, although the rear isn't really a problem in most ABS needing situations.

I did it because I snapped a drive shaft.

you would probably wanna upgrade sway bar and traction brackets etc... rb25 box's are probably the strongest outta skyline boxes.... tail shaft will be fine... ur diff on the other hand might not last too long... if your serious and have the $ to back ya idd go borg warner 28 spline or 31 spline diff outta vl or r31... they run 9's in em just fine so you'd think they'd be good but you needa modify/change the brackets etc...
